How We Tackle Crawl Space Mold Head-On
Getting rid of mold in your crawl space requires more than just a quick spray. It demands a systematic approach that addresses the moisture source, safely removes the mold, and implements measures to prevent its return. Cutting corners here can lead to mold spores spreading further, making the problem worse and potentially costing you more down the line. Our process is designed for complete mold eradication and long-term protection.
Initial Assessment and Containment
The first step is a thorough inspection of your crawl space to determine the extent of the mold growth and identify all moisture sources. We’ll then set up containment barriers using specialized equipment to prevent mold spores from spreading into the rest of your home during the remediation process. This typically takes a few hours, depending on the size of the crawl space and the complexity of the issue.
Air Purification and Deodorization
Once containment is established, we use industrial-grade air scrubbers and HEPA filters to remove airborne mold spores and other contaminants from the air. This is crucial for improving your home’s air quality and ensuring a healthy living environment. This phase can last anywhere from 24 to 72 hours, depending on the severity of the contamination.
Mold Removal and Cleaning
Our crews use specialized cleaning agents and techniques to safely remove mold from all affected surfaces, including wood, concrete, and insulation. We pay close attention to every nook and cranny to ensure thorough mold elimination. This part of the process can take anywhere from a day to several days, depending on the mold’s spread.
Moisture Source Control
This is where we get to the root of the problem. We’ll help you identify and address the moisture issues, whether it’s a leaking pipe, poor ventilation, or groundwater intrusion. This might involve installing vapor barriers, improving drainage, or recommending repairs. Addressing the source is key to preventing future mold growth and typically takes a day or two to implement.
Final Inspection and Clearance
Before we consider the job done, we conduct a final inspection and air quality test to confirm that the mold has been successfully removed and your crawl space is safe. We want you to feel confident that your home is protected. This final verification usually takes a few hours.

Warning Signs You Need Crawl Space Mold Remediation
Catching mold early is always better than dealing with a full-blown infestation. The sooner you recognize these signs, the easier and less costly it will be to address the problem. Your home’s health often starts from the ground up, so pay attention to what’s happening below your floors.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
The most common indicator of crawl space mold is a persistent musty or earthy smell that seems to come from your floors or vents. This smell is caused by mold spores releasing VOCs (volatile organic compounds) into the air. Don’t ignore persistent smells, especially after rain.
Visible Mold Growth
Sometimes, mold can be seen as fuzzy or slimy patches of black, green, white, or even orange. It often appears on damp wood, insulation, or concrete surfaces. If you can safely access your crawl space, keep an eye out for any unusual discoloration.
Increased Humidity Levels
If your home feels unusually damp or humid, even when the air conditioning is running, it could be a sign of excess moisture in your crawl space. This high humidity creates an ideal breeding ground for mold. Monitor indoor humidity closely, especially during warmer months.
Water Stains or Damage
Look for water stains on your subflooring or the foundation walls within your crawl space. These indicate areas where water has been present, providing the necessary conditions for mold to thrive. Water damage is a mold magnet.
Health Symptoms
If you or your family members are experiencing unexplained allergy symptoms like sneezing, coughing, itchy eyes, or respiratory issues, it could be due to mold spores in your air. Your health matters, and mold can be a significant factor.
Sagging Floors or Damaged Insulation
Severe mold growth can weaken wooden structures over time, leading to sagging floors. Mold can also degrade insulation, reducing its effectiveness and potentially causing more moisture problems. Structural integrity is vital.
Crawl Space Mold Remediation v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, isolated patch of surface mold on a non-porous material. | Yes, with caution. | No. | Easily cleaned with household products, low risk of spread. |
| Mold covering a larger area (more than a few square feet). | No. | Yes. | Risk of spore dispersal is high, requires specialized equipment. |
| Mold on porous materials like wood, drywall, or insulation. | No. | Yes. | Mold penetrates deeply, often requiring material removal and professional cleaning. |
| Persistent musty odors but no visible mold. | No. | Yes. | Mold may be hidden, requiring advanced detection and air testing. |
| Concerns about health effects from mold exposure. | No. | Yes. | Professionals use protective gear and containment to minimize exposure. |
| Suspected mold after significant water intrusion or flooding. | No. | Yes. | Requires immediate, extensive drying and mold remediation to prevent widespread growth. |

Crawl Space Mold Remediation Cost In Sacaton, AZ
The cost for mold remediation in your crawl space can vary quite a bit depending on the size of the affected area, the severity of the mold growth, and any necessary structural repairs or moisture control measures. These figures are general estimates for Sacaton, AZ, and an on-site assessment is always needed for an exact quote.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Crawl Space Mold Inspection & Assessment | $300 – $800 | Size of crawl space, complexity of access, need for air testing. |
| Containment Setup & Air Purification | $500 – $1,500 | Size of area to be contained, duration of air scrubbing needed. |
| Surface Mold Removal (up to 100 sq ft) | $700 – $2,000 | Type of surfaces affected, amount of material needing cleaning. |
| Extensive Mold Removal (over 100 sq ft) | $1,500 – $5,000+ | Severity of mold, accessibility, need for demolition/removal of materials. |
| Vapor Barrier Installation | $1,000 – $3,000 | Square footage of crawl space, type of material used. |
| Post-Remediation Testing | $200 – $600 | Number of samples taken, type of testing required. |

Common Questions About Crawl Space Mold Remediation
How long does crawl space mold remediation usually take?
The timeline for crawl space mold remediation can vary, but a typical job might take 2 to 5 days. This includes the assessment, containment, cleaning, and drying phases. We work efficiently to minimize disruption, but thoroughness is our priority to ensure complete mold removal and prevent its return.
Is crawl space mold dangerous to my health?
Yes, it can be. Mold spores released in the crawl space can travel through your home’s ventilation system, potentially causing or exacerbating respiratory issues, allergies, and other health problems. What happens if I don’t fix crawl space mold?
If left untreated, crawl space mold can spread extensively, damaging structural components of your home like wooden beams and subflooring. It can also significantly degrade your home’s indoor air quality, leading to persistent health issues and costly structural repairs down the line. We help you avoid these long-term consequences.
Can I prevent mold from growing in my crawl space?
Yes, prevention is key. Maintaining proper ventilation, controlling humidity levels, ensuring good drainage around your foundation, and promptly fixing any leaks are crucial steps.
